Webmul·ti·tude (mŭl′tĭ-to͞od′, -tyo͞od′) n. 1. A very great number. 2. The masses; the populace: the concerns of the multitude. [Middle English, from Old French, from Latin multitūdō, from multus, many; see mel- in Indo-European roots.] Synonyms: multitude, army, host2, legion These nouns denote a large number of people or things that have ...
